John Cena along with the Beginning from the Spinner Belt
The copyright Spinner Belt was born out of John Cena's increase to superstardom. Cena had currently made a reputation for himself together with his “Medical professional of Thuganomics” persona—a rapper-design gimmick total with freestyles, chains, and throwback manner. Just after successful the copyright Championship at copyright 21 in 2005, Cena unveiled a brand name-new title structure: the Spinner Belt.

The belt highlighted a big copyright symbol at the center, which could spin similar to a set of rims with a flashy auto. This was a direct nod to hip-hop lifestyle, exactly where spinning rims on cars and trucks have been a standing symbol. For Cena, the belt beautifully reflected his character as well as era’s vibe.

A Belt That Broke Custom
Prior to the Spinner Belt, copyright championships had a far more traditional, reserved style and design. Titles such as the Winged Eagle as well as Undisputed Championship looked significant and prestigious, emphasizing custom and athletic excellence.

The Spinner Belt, Then again, was all about aptitude. It was flashy, oversized, and unapologetically loud. It represented A serious change in copyright’s branding—from traditional pro wrestling toward athletics leisure. The new style aimed to seize the eye of the young, pop-culture-savvy audience.

Despite the fact that at first created for John Cena, the Spinner Belt wasn’t just a one particular-off. It turned the default copyright Championship for another 8 years, held by superstars like Edge, Randy Orton, Triple H, CM Punk, as well as the Miz.

Retirement plus the Return to Prestige
In 2013, The Rock defeated CM Punk to be copyright Champion and quickly released a new version of your title, proficiently retiring the Spinner Belt. The new belt retained a contemporary design and style but ditched the spinning feature in favor of a more Expert glance.

The Spinner Belt’s retirement was satisfied with blended reactions. Some were relieved to discover a return to tradition, while some felt nostalgic for the era it represented. No matter, its departure marked the end of a singular chapter in copyright history.
